Subsequently, the situation remains calm as student protestors begin to disperse, following the serving and reading of a court interdict. The interdict is to protect the rights of all University stakeholders; those who wish to access the University to work and/or pursue their studies; as well as those wishing to exercise their right to protest in accordance with the conditions stipulated in the interdict.
A memorandum from the protesting students, focusing mainly on general security concerns on and off campus, has been received and is under discussion, albeit that they are already being addressed. The University has also planned a meeting with SAPS around policing and other addition measures towards improved security.
